Obtenir VMWare ESXi 5.0.0 avec RAID à l'aide du chipset Intel X79 pour fonctionner

J'ai acheté un nouveau server où j'utilise la carte mère ASUS P9X79 WS X79 S-2011 ATX . Il sera utilisé pour la virtualisation, de preference en utilisant VMware vSphere Hypervisor ™ (ESXi) si je peux get le RAID sur ma carte mère fonctionnant avec VMWare (il ne le détecte pas).

La carte mère possède le chipset Intel® X79, qui, pour le controller RAID, désigne l' ID 8086 (Intel) du fournisseur et l'ID model 2826 .

Lorsque je lance le support d'installation ESXi 5.0.0 à partir de mon lecteur flash, je ne vois pas les lecteurs dans le jeu RAID5 que j'ai créé.

Des questions:

  • Existe-t-il un file VIB pour le controller RAID que je peux utiliser?

  • J'ai trouvé un article sur http://www.intel.com/support/motherboards/server/sb/CS-033313.htm pour que RAID fonctionne avec certains controllers Intel, il répertorie 9 modules RAID embeddeds avec lesquels il est comptabilisé. Cependant, il n'y a aucune mention du chipset X79.

5 Solutions collect form web for “Obtenir VMWare ESXi 5.0.0 avec RAID à l'aide du chipset Intel X79 pour fonctionner”

Le RAID sur cette carte mère n'est pas un RAID matériel réel, c'est « fakeraid » qui dépend des drivers du operating system. ESXi ne prend pas en charge fakeraid, car il vise des environnements d'entreprise (qui utilisent un RAID matériel réel pour de meilleures performances) et non des PC grand public (qui utilisent fakeraid car il est bon marché). ESXi doit reconnaître les lecteurs connectés à ce controller, mais uniquement en tant que lecteurs autonomes, et non pas en RAID.

Vous voudrez peut-être opter pour une plate-forme de virtualisation différente, telle que Cisortingx XenServer ou Linux KVM . Si vous souhaitez vraiment utiliser ESXi, vous pouvez configurer vos trois lecteurs en tant que magasins de données distincts, donner à chacun de vos VM trois disques virtuels – un à partir de chaque magasin de données – et configurer un RAID logiciel dans le operating system de chaque machine virtuelle.

(Les machines virtuelles ne pourront pas voir le controller fakeraid de l'hôte. L'isolement des hôtes du matériel de l'hôte est à moitié le sharepoint la virtualisation. Les invités ne verront que leurs disques virtuels.)

Il existe des pilotes non officiels que vous pouvez installer sur ESXi pour prendre en charge un matériel supplémentaire, y compris un "dmraid" pour Intel Masortingx RAID (le fakeraid de votre chipset), mais vous allez sur un membre si vous le faites.

Je pense que, ici, vous obtiendrez de nombreuses personnes suggérant un lecteur supplémentaire et RAID 10 plutôt que RAID 5 car la performance d'écriture est beaucoup plus élevée sous la charge. Personnellement, je dirais si les lecteurs ne verront pas les IOPS élevés (surtout les IOPS randoms) alors RAID 5 le ferait.

Cependant, j'ai remarqué que vous avez choisi des lecteurs WD Green SATA – je considérerais cela comme un très mauvais choix. Les lecteurs verts ont normalement une vitesse plus lente (rpm) et sont configurés pour tourner pendant les périodes d'inactivité, que le operating system ait ou non indiqué. Vraiment, vous voulez des lecteurs SAS 15K et un controller RAID de sauvegarde sur batterie.

Si vous lisez le lien Intel que vous avez fourni, vous verrez à partir de la page 41 le guide décrit la configuration d'un server 2k8, l'installation de RAID Web Console 2 sur le server, puis la configuration de l'hôte ESXi. Cela devrait vous permettre de savoir si un disque a échoué via une window contextuelle et un courrier électronique.

ESXi sur un pinceau – le levier sera probablement plus lent que le démarrage à partir d'un RAID, et il n'y a pas de redondance pour l'hôte ESXi lui-même, juste le VM. Cependant, si vous avez un problème avec votre installation ESXi ou votre thumbstick, il n'est pas nécessaire de configurer un nouveau puis d'importer les VM. Sur un server de production, je ne considérerais ceci que si le vôtre, le port USB est interne.

OK, les réponses précédentes ont parlé de pourquoi il est une mauvaise idée d'utiliser fakeraid, pourquoi VMware ne le prend pas en charge et, dans une certaine mesure, pourquoi utiliser une carte mère de bureau n'est pas une bonne idée.

Si vous êtes vraiment prêt à utiliser cette carte comme base pour un server VMware, voici ce que vous faites:

  1. Aller à eBay.
  2. Rechercher DELL PERC 6/i . Achetez un, de preference celui qui comprend une batterie. Il s'agit d'un controller RAID matériel réel qui est compatible avec VMware vSphere. Ne reçois pas de carte 6 / iR.
  3. Si la carte n'est pas livrée avec un câble de lecteur, searchz le SFF-8484 SFF-8482 et achetez l'un des câbles indiqués. Ce câble vous permet de connecter jusqu'à quatre lecteurs SAS ou SATA au 6 / i.
  4. Quand ils arrivent tous, installez le 6 / i dans l'un des locations PCI Express de votre ordinateur et connectez les lecteurs au 6 / i avec le câble.
  5. Utilisez le 6 / i RAID BIOS pour créer votre réseau RAID.
  6. Installez VMware vSphere Hypervisor.

Prendre plaisir!

Non, vous ne pouvez pas utiliser le raid Intel ICHR pour vSphere / ESXi. La raison en est parce que le raid n'existe pas comme un volume à exposer à travers un pilote de controller (la véritable explication de ce que tous les enfants appellent «fakeraid»).

Toutes les solutions RAID sont basées sur des logiciels, mais ce que la plupart appellent «RAID matériel» sont des solutions où le logiciel RAID fonctionne sur le controller («firmware») et donc lorsque vous utilisez un pilote pour permettre à votre O / S (ESXi dans ce cas) pour voir les volumes (non-RAID tels que SATA, IDE ou Adaptateurs de bus hôte, comme les HBA exposent les lecteurs au lieu des volumes), l'O / S a beaucoup less de travail pour le faire avec une solution RAID logicielle plus typique. ICHR est une solution hybride intéressante où le chipset SouthBridge fournit en fait un microprogramme pour le RAID et un BIOS où vous pouvez effectuer une configuration de base. Il ne fournit pas un chargeur de démarrage INT19 approprié, ce qui signifie que les volumes de RAID qu'il présente ne peuvent pas démarrer et en fait, n'existent pas jusqu'à ce que le service IAStor démarre, utilise le pilote ICHR pour voir les volumes, alors les présente à l'O / S.

Windows peut faire face à cela grâce à son process de démarrage et j'imagine que VMWare pourrait aussi bien, mais ils ne le feront jamais parce que, comme d'autres l'ont souligné, ICHR RAID n'est pas «pro grade» en raison de son manque de processeur de parité dédié (ICHR utilise votre x86 CPU qui fait réellement un travail remarquable lors de la configuration correcte) et les dangers inhérents à cela, comme le fait que votre CPU est un processeur à usage général faisant beaucoup d'autres choses, ce qui rend plus propice à l'écrasement qu'un processeur de parité dédié. L'absence de certains caches / tampons et une bonne sauvegarde de la batterie pour les transactions non validées rendent également le risque élevé de l'ICHR par rapport aux solutions "RAID matérielles".

À la fin, ICHR est une solution à valeur ajoutée pour les personnes qui n'ont pas besoin de 6 9 (99,9999%) de time de fonctionnement et risquent de ralentir les time d'arrêt et la perte de données mineures. Si vous voulez jouer avec une solution vraiment intéressante, obtenez une licence communautaire pour NexentaStor 3.x, installez vSphere sur n'importe quel lecteur / tableau que vous pouvez mettre en main, créez une VM pour NexentaStor et installez-la, apprenez comment faire RDM ( Raw Device Mapping) et exposez vos lecteurs à votre NexentaStor VM via RDM, puis exposez NFS d'iSCSI de THAT VM au même hôte et utilisez cette solution SAN pour vos autres machines virtuelles et d'autres systèmes sur votre réseau. De cette façon, vous pouvez profiter des performances des disques bruts, ZFS (RAIDz et les préférés), et apprendre toutes sortes de choses intéressantes concernant l'utilisation de SAN d'entreprise avec vSphere et la virtualisation. C'est un projet mais fait correctement (jettez quelques SSD de 60 Go stratégiquement pour le cache / ZIL), vous apprendrez beaucoup et disposez d'un stockage extrêmement flexible, portable et extensible qui est agnostique pour le matériel.

Malheureusement, il n'y a pas de file VIB pour le Chipset X79. Si vous utilisez un logiciel RAID, je recommand une plate-forme de virtualisation qui s'exécute sur une dissortingbution Linux avec un meilleur support matériel. Par exemple, Virtualbox fonctionnant sur Ubuntu Server fonctionnerait.

  • Mise en place d'une équipe sur Esxi
  • La performance du réseau ESXi 5 est lente
  • Dépannage de VMWare ESXi 5 Redémarrages spontanés
  • Version recommandée de vmtools pour Ubuntu?
  • Le cluster VMware HA à deux nœuds - la politique de contrôle d'admission?
  • VMWARE Guest Storage VMDK vs RDM-V vs RMD-P
  • Ajouter un sous-réseau à un vsphere avec un seul hôte vcenter et esxi
  • Fiabilité de VMware ESXi pour la sauvegarde
  • Comment récupérer à partir de "Mouvement de lecteur invalide" (HP SmartArray P411)
  • iSCSI opcode , erreur (-65539)
  • VMware ESXi - time de CPU variable (réservation de CPU)
  • Les astuces du serveur de linux et windows, tels que ubuntu, centos, apache, nginx, debian et des sujets de rĂ©seau.